As part of the National Association of
Round Tables, Knowle & Dorridge
Round Table carries out its purpose
through a nationally set standard
approach adopted by all Round Tables
in the UK. Round Table members meet
twice a month for social activities,
quarterly for business meetings, and
annually for the AGM. We run three
charity fundraisers annually; Dorridge
Day, Santa float, K&D Drinks Festival.

Para 1.20 We held three main fundraising events
this year as per usual – Dorridge Day,
Knowle Beer Festival and Santa Float
collecting. Overall these three events
raised approximately £29,000.
Combined with previous years’
fundraising this allowed generous
donations to good causes of well over
£20,000.
